基于javaweb开发的食品网络商店系统类别设计类(类□其他□(附件)【字数:7095】
基于JavaWeb开发的食品网络商店系统是把线下的食品销售与信息技术、电子商务结合在一起,来实现对食品网上销售的目的。食品网络商店系统分为了消费者模块和管理员模块,消费者模块主要是消费者注册个人资料,然后进行登录。未登录的用户可以进行食品的浏览搜索,按照关键字和食品的分类进行搜索,登录的用户可以把食品加入到购物车,购物车会计算食品的总价格,然后确认订单后就可以提交完成购买。在用户中心中可以查看到自己的食品购买订单,以及对个人注册的资料进行修改。管理员模块主要是食品分类和食品基本信息的添加和管理,以及对消费者购买的食品订单进行查看和发货处理。食品网络商店系统是基于B/S模式的,采用了Java和MySQL结合来实现的。系统的完成为商家建立了网络销售渠道,节约费用的同时也带来了更多的客户资源,提高了食品的销售额。消费者在网上购买食品也更加的方便。
Keywords: Ecommerce; shopping cart; delivery processing; Java目录
一、绪论 1
(一) 研究背景 1
(二) 研究意义 1
二、系统分析 1
(一) 功能需求分析 1
(二) 系统用例分析 2
(三)系统结构 3
(四)数据分析 3
三、数据库设计 5
(一)概念结构设计 5
(二)逻辑关系设计 6
(三)物理结构设计 7
四、系统设计与实现 8
(一) 消费者模块 8
1.消费者注册 8
2.消费者登录 9
3.食品浏览搜索 10
4.购物车 11
5.我的订单 12
6.个人信息修改 12
(二) 管理员模块 13
1.食品类型管理 13
2.食品管理 14
3.订单管理 15
4.消费者管理 16
5.系统管理 16
五、系统测试 17
(一) 测试目的和方法 17
(二) 测试用例 17
总结 19
致谢 19< *好棒文|www.hbsrm.com +Q: ¥351916072$
br /> 参考文献 20
一、绪论
(一) 研究背景
随着网络和电子商务的发展,国内网购的人群数量每年都在增加,特别是智能手机的普及应用,网上购买商品变的更加的简单。现在京东、淘宝、拼多多等大型电商平台的出现,特别是在双十一等大型电商活动时期,每年的成交量都达到了上千亿,这充分说明了当前人们的网购能力是非常强大的。特别是在当前新型冠状病毒的影响下,网上购买商品的优势更加的明显,足不出户就可以购买到各种日常用品。在疫情期间对于食品的需求是非常大的,现在很多大型的超市都具有网上购物的平台,并且一定范围的内的都可以在一个小时左右就可以配送到。还有些商家是通过京东、淘宝等大型电商平台来销售食品。不管是哪种方式都说明了食品的销售早就已经进入到网上销售模式中。
(二) 研究意义
食品网络商店系统的建立满足了人们网上购买食品的基本需求,也为商家带来了更多的客户资源,通过网络可以把商家的食品销售到国内各地的消费者手中,增加了商家的销售量,带来了更多的收入。同时商家也不需要花费太多的钱去租赁店铺,只需要推广的费用。商家也可以通过平台上传更多的食品信息。在食品的种类和数量上要比传统的线下商店要多很多,同时销售时间也不受限制,消费者可以在任何时间下单,商家在后台就可以看到订单,然后就可以配送。对于消费者来说,可以足不出门就可以购买中各种类型的食品,而且购买的食品相对线下商品还要便宜,食品的种类、数量比较多,选择的空间也比较大。食品网络商店系统为商家和消费者建立了一个网上交易的渠道,节约了消费者的时间、节约了商家的费用,提高了食品买卖的效率。
二、系统分析
(一) 功能需求分析
基于JavaWeb的食品网络商店系统主要实现食品的网上销售,实现对食品的发布、展示、查询搜索、购买、发货等过程,具体的功能需求如下。
1.前台中可以展示食品的信息,包括食品的图片、名称、价格、介绍等。
3.前台中可以进行消费者个人信息的注册,并实现登录验证。
4.前台中消费者可以选购食品先加入到购物车中,然后确定订单后就可以下单。
5.消费者登录后可以进行个人购买食品订单的查看,也可以对自己的个人信息进行修改。
6.后台管理中可以对食品的分类和食品的基本信息进行添加和管理,添加食品时要具有名称、价格、分类、图片、详细介绍等内容。
7.后台管理员中可以完成对消费者购买食品订单的查看和发货处理。
8.后台管理中可以对注册的消费者进行管理。
(二) 系统用例分析
食品网络商品系统是一个关于商家和消费者进行食品买卖的平台,包括的用户应该有商家管理员和前台消费者用户。
1.前台消费者是整个系统的主要用户,在系统中完成的功能有用户注册、登录、食品搜索、食品下单购买、订单查看以及个人基本信息的修改。前台消费者的用例图如图31所示。
表21 前台消费者用例图
2.管理员用户是系统的管理者,在系统中完成的功能有出售食品类型的设置和食品信息的上传管理,以及对消费者购买食品的订单进行查看和处理,还可以对注册的消费者信息进行查看和管理,并对自己的登录密码有修改的权限。商家用户的用例图如图22所示。
表22 管理员用户用例图
(三)系统结构
基于JavaWeb的食品网络商店系统包括了消费者模块和管理员模块组成,前台模块总包括了消费者注册、消费者登录、食品浏览查询、购物车、查看订单、修改个人信息。管理员模块中包括了食品类型管理、食品管理、订单管理、消费者管理、系统管理。基于JavaWeb的食品网络商店系统的功能结构图如图21所示。
图21 功能结构图
(四)数据分析
基于JavaWeb的食品网络商店系统的数据主要有食品分类信息、食品信息、订单信息、订单明细信息、消费者信息。
1.食品分类信息的分析如表21所示。
表21 食品分类信息
数据存储名称
食品分类信息
简述
存储每个食品的分类名称
数据流来源
Keywords: Ecommerce; shopping cart; delivery processing; Java目录
一、绪论 1
(一) 研究背景 1
(二) 研究意义 1
二、系统分析 1
(一) 功能需求分析 1
(二) 系统用例分析 2
(三)系统结构 3
(四)数据分析 3
三、数据库设计 5
(一)概念结构设计 5
(二)逻辑关系设计 6
(三)物理结构设计 7
四、系统设计与实现 8
(一) 消费者模块 8
1.消费者注册 8
2.消费者登录 9
3.食品浏览搜索 10
4.购物车 11
5.我的订单 12
6.个人信息修改 12
(二) 管理员模块 13
1.食品类型管理 13
2.食品管理 14
3.订单管理 15
4.消费者管理 16
5.系统管理 16
五、系统测试 17
(一) 测试目的和方法 17
(二) 测试用例 17
总结 19
致谢 19< *好棒文|www.hbsrm.com +Q: ¥351916072$
br /> 参考文献 20
一、绪论
(一) 研究背景
随着网络和电子商务的发展,国内网购的人群数量每年都在增加,特别是智能手机的普及应用,网上购买商品变的更加的简单。现在京东、淘宝、拼多多等大型电商平台的出现,特别是在双十一等大型电商活动时期,每年的成交量都达到了上千亿,这充分说明了当前人们的网购能力是非常强大的。特别是在当前新型冠状病毒的影响下,网上购买商品的优势更加的明显,足不出户就可以购买到各种日常用品。在疫情期间对于食品的需求是非常大的,现在很多大型的超市都具有网上购物的平台,并且一定范围的内的都可以在一个小时左右就可以配送到。还有些商家是通过京东、淘宝等大型电商平台来销售食品。不管是哪种方式都说明了食品的销售早就已经进入到网上销售模式中。
(二) 研究意义
食品网络商店系统的建立满足了人们网上购买食品的基本需求,也为商家带来了更多的客户资源,通过网络可以把商家的食品销售到国内各地的消费者手中,增加了商家的销售量,带来了更多的收入。同时商家也不需要花费太多的钱去租赁店铺,只需要推广的费用。商家也可以通过平台上传更多的食品信息。在食品的种类和数量上要比传统的线下商店要多很多,同时销售时间也不受限制,消费者可以在任何时间下单,商家在后台就可以看到订单,然后就可以配送。对于消费者来说,可以足不出门就可以购买中各种类型的食品,而且购买的食品相对线下商品还要便宜,食品的种类、数量比较多,选择的空间也比较大。食品网络商店系统为商家和消费者建立了一个网上交易的渠道,节约了消费者的时间、节约了商家的费用,提高了食品买卖的效率。
二、系统分析
(一) 功能需求分析
基于JavaWeb的食品网络商店系统主要实现食品的网上销售,实现对食品的发布、展示、查询搜索、购买、发货等过程,具体的功能需求如下。
1.前台中可以展示食品的信息,包括食品的图片、名称、价格、介绍等。
3.前台中可以进行消费者个人信息的注册,并实现登录验证。
4.前台中消费者可以选购食品先加入到购物车中,然后确定订单后就可以下单。
5.消费者登录后可以进行个人购买食品订单的查看,也可以对自己的个人信息进行修改。
6.后台管理中可以对食品的分类和食品的基本信息进行添加和管理,添加食品时要具有名称、价格、分类、图片、详细介绍等内容。
7.后台管理员中可以完成对消费者购买食品订单的查看和发货处理。
8.后台管理中可以对注册的消费者进行管理。
(二) 系统用例分析
食品网络商品系统是一个关于商家和消费者进行食品买卖的平台,包括的用户应该有商家管理员和前台消费者用户。
1.前台消费者是整个系统的主要用户,在系统中完成的功能有用户注册、登录、食品搜索、食品下单购买、订单查看以及个人基本信息的修改。前台消费者的用例图如图31所示。
表21 前台消费者用例图
2.管理员用户是系统的管理者,在系统中完成的功能有出售食品类型的设置和食品信息的上传管理,以及对消费者购买食品的订单进行查看和处理,还可以对注册的消费者信息进行查看和管理,并对自己的登录密码有修改的权限。商家用户的用例图如图22所示。
表22 管理员用户用例图
(三)系统结构
基于JavaWeb的食品网络商店系统包括了消费者模块和管理员模块组成,前台模块总包括了消费者注册、消费者登录、食品浏览查询、购物车、查看订单、修改个人信息。管理员模块中包括了食品类型管理、食品管理、订单管理、消费者管理、系统管理。基于JavaWeb的食品网络商店系统的功能结构图如图21所示。
图21 功能结构图
(四)数据分析
基于JavaWeb的食品网络商店系统的数据主要有食品分类信息、食品信息、订单信息、订单明细信息、消费者信息。
1.食品分类信息的分析如表21所示。
表21 食品分类信息
数据存储名称
食品分类信息
简述
存储每个食品的分类名称
数据流来源
版权保护: 本文由 hbsrm.com编辑,转载请保留链接: www.hbsrm.com/jsj/rjgc/173.html